Who funds Eastside Academy?

Eastside Academy is funded by 24 grantmakers, led by Harnish Foundation ($800K), Byron & Alice Lockwood Foundation ($340K), Stewardship Foundation ($340K). In total, IRS Form 990 filings record $2.4M in grants to Eastside Academy between 2019–2025.
